Craft a Compelling Headline

Your headline is the first thing potential clients notice. This is why it must grab attention instantly. Use clear, concise language to convey your expertise in website design. Consider including specific skills or achievements. These must be related to website design to make your headline more impactful. Your headline should reflect your unique selling point in website design. This sets you apart from others.

Make sure it aligns with the services you offer and what clients are likely searching for. Remember that a well-crafted headline can draw in clients looking for website design professionals exactly like you.

Avoid jargon and keep it simple, ensuring anyone can understand what you bring to the table. In a sea of freelancers, a compelling headline can be the key to more inquiries and job offers in website design.

Show Your Experience with Projects

The projects section of your profile is where you can showcase your past work in website design. Start by selecting projects that best represent your skills and achievements. Use clear and simple descriptions to explain each project.

Mention the challenges you faced and how you solved them. This will highlight your problem-solving skills. Include the technologies and tools you used to complete the projects. This gives potential clients a better understanding of your expertise.

Adding visuals, like screenshots, can make your projects more engaging. This also helps clients visualize your work. Ensure that each project listed is relevant to the services you offer. This reinforces your credibility as a skilled website designer.

Adjust Rates Competitively

Setting your rates competitively is crucial for attracting clients on freelance platforms. You should research market rates for website designers in your field. This allows you to position your pricing fairly and attract a wide range of clients.

Offering introductory rates for new clients can also be a good strategy. Consider your experience and the complexity of the projects when setting your rates.

Keep your rates transparent and easy to understand. This builds trust with potential clients and avoids confusion. Regularly review and adjust your rates based on your growing expertise and market trends.
